Oppo looking to develop own in-house chipset for future flagships


With Google’s long-awaited Pixel 6 event finally in the books we can look forward to how the custom Tensor chipset sitting at the helm of the new devices performs in the real world. It seems another smartphone OEM is looking to follow in Google’s footsteps with a report from Nikkei Asia saying Oppo is already planning its own custom system on a chip (SoC) which should be implemented in its flagships as early as 2023.
